NCT01317901
This was a Phase 1 multicenter study of bendamustine, rituximab and TRU-016 (BRT) in subjects with relapsed indolent B-cell lymphoma. This was a multiple-dose escalation study to determine the maximum-tolerated dose (MTD) of TRU-016 given in combination with rituximab and bendamustine and to determine a safe dosing regimen for the combination in up to 12 subjects with relapsed indolent lymphoma. The originally planned Phase 2 portion, an open-label, randomized study to evaluate the efficacy of BRT compared with BR, was not conducted.
NCT00662311
This phase I/II trial studies the side effects and best dose of vorinostat when given together with paclitaxel and radiation therapy and to see how well it works in treating patients unable to tolerate cisplatin with stage III non-small cell lung cancer (NSCLC) that cannot be removed by surgery. Vorinostat may stop the growth of tumor cells by blocking some of the enzymes needed for cell growth. Drugs used in chemotherapy, such as paclitaxel, work in different ways to stop the growth of tumor cells, either by killing the cells or by stopping them from dividing.
